In September 2024, TERRE Liban, in partnership with Friedrich Ebert Stiftung, proudly hosted the inaugural Youth Climate Academy in the picturesque town of Douma, North Lebanon. This transformative initiative brought together 20 dynamic young men and women from across Lebanon, selected for their passion and potential to lead change in their communities. Held from September 3 to September 5, the Academy marked a milestone in empowering Lebanon’s youth to take an active role in addressing climate change and fostering sustainable development.
